Wally's new wallypower50X

Wally has unveiled the new wallypower50X in a world premiere at the Discover Boating Miami International Boat Show. The model represents an outboard-powered evolution of the well-known wallypower50, continuing the brand’s focus on combining innovation, performance and futuristic design.

The wallypower50X expands Wally’s motor yacht range with a more versatile interpretation of the wallypower concept. According to the brand, the model reflects its philosophy of balancing form and function, technology and emotion, and elegance with performance.

Signature Wally design

The new model retains the distinctive features that define the wallypower family. These include a vertical bow, sharp profile and extensive glazed surfaces designed to merge aesthetics with functionality.

Design details such as the brand’s ‘magic portholes’ introduce natural light to the interior while maintaining the clean exterior lines. The anchoring system is fully concealed, contributing to a minimalist appearance when the boat is at anchor.

The glazed superstructure and open deck aim to provide a balance between comfort and style. Modular design allows the boat to be configured for several roles, including chase boat, superyacht tender, day cruiser or weekender.

Wally wallypower50X underway at speed, showcasing its sharp bow, glazed superstructure and quad Mercury outboards in turquoise water.

Expansive Deck and Social Spaces

Fold-down transom sides increase usable deck space by more than five square metres, creating a closer connection with the water. On deck, the layout includes two large sunpads and a dining area for eight beneath the glazed structure.

The design encourages informal socialising, with a lounge area and kitchenette supporting relaxed day use.

Below deck, accommodation includes a double bed, lounge area and a bathroom with a separate shower, enabling the boat to support weekend stays and mid-range cruising.

Mercury Outboard Performance

The wallypower50X introduces Mercury outboard propulsion to the Wally range. The standard configuration uses Mercury Verado V10 425 hp engines, delivering a reported top speed of 50 knots and a cruising speed of 34 knots (preliminary data).

An optional Mercury Racing V8 500 hp setup, installed on hull number two unveiled in Miami, increases performance to a top speed of 54 knots and a cruising speed of 36 knots (preliminary data).

The hull design was developed through collaboration between the Wally team and Ferretti Group Engineering to provide stability and control at higher speeds.

With the introduction of the wallypower50X, Wally extends its wallypower line into the outboard segment while maintaining its established design language.
